Job Description

Compucom Systems, Inc. provides end-to-end IT managed services to enable the digital workplace for enterprise, midsize and small businesses. To enable our clients to focus on what matters most, we employ a customer-centric, hard-working, and talented group of people that Act Like an Owner, Do the Right Thing, and Have Fun Doing It! We're looking for a Field Tech II to join our team. The IT Field Technician will provide onsite technical support for a national home improvement retail client.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ys hands-on IT work, troubleshooting, and working in a fast-paced field environment.
Responsibilities:
Provide onsite support for IT equipment including POS systems, desktops, printers, thin clients, access points, and network devices Troubleshoot and resolve hardware, software, and network issues Perform installations, upgrades, and break/fix support Support copper and fiber cabling, including basic terminations Document all work, updates, and resolutions in ticketing systems Travel daily within a 125+ mile radius (route-based travel) Work with remote teams to resolve escalated technical issues Occasionally work at heights (20-25 feet) and lift up to 25 lbs
Qualifications:
1+ year of IT technical support or field technician experience CompTIA A+ (required), Network+ preferred Experience with Windows, macOS, or Linux environments Familiarity with networking fundamentals and IT hardware Experience with cabling (copper/fiber) is a plus Strong communication and customer service skills Valid driver's license required
